Defining Proximity: Technical Challenges

Proximity detection in near me applications depends on a combination of sensors, software algorithms, and network connectivity. However, accurately determining the proximity of users to points of interest (POIs) is a complex task due to several limitations. Device capabilities, such as GPS, Wi-Fi, and Bluetooth signals, can vary significantly across different hardware and software configurations. These variations impact the accuracy and consistency of proximity detection, making it essential to develop and integrate sophisticated algorithms that can adapt to changing conditions.

Signal Strength and Network Connectivity

Signal strength and network connectivity are critical factors in determining the proximity of users to POIs. However, these factors often fluctuate due to external environmental conditions, such as building density, network congestion, and interference from other devices. To mitigate these limitations, near me applications employ various techniques, including signal amplitude measurements, data fusion, and advanced networking protocols.

Data Fusion and Algorithm Development, Captain jay’s near me

Data fusion involves combining multiple sources of location data to improve the accuracy and robustness of proximity detection. Advanced algorithms can be developed to process and integrate data from various sensors, such as GPS, accelerometers, and gyroscopes, which enables near me applications to make informed decisions about a user’s proximity to POIs. Some examples of data fusion techniques include:

  • Weighted average of multiple signal strengths
  • Prediction-based algorithms using machine learning models
  • Covariance-based techniques for noise reduction and signal filtering
